Jean Philippe is Professor of Pediatrics at the University of Ottawa and Senior Scientist with the ‘Healthy Active Living and Obesity Research Group’ at the Children’s Hospital of Eastern Ontario Research Institute. His research focuses on obesity prevention, health promotion, and lifestyle behaviour modification, including improving sleep, increasing physical activity, reducing screen time, and fostering healthier eating habits.

Richard graduated from Glasgow University as a vet in 1998, and spent time at Cambridge University before returning to Scotland.  He was awarded a Wellcome Trust Clinical Training Fellowship to undertake studies into T cell activation and regulation in diabetes and awarded a PhD in 2007.  Richard runs a basic science and clinical research programme at Edinburgh University where he moved in 2007, focused on further understanding of how nutrition influences health outcomes and the immune system.
